So how does the pellet heater actually work? The patented burner allows smokeless burning of wood pellets without any electricity. The construction of this hi-tech burner is only achieved in Austria by being able to precision-cut parts within millimetres of tolerance.

The construction of the ParcHaus Cube Pellet Burner allows for controlled burning. This means that the radius and height of the flame are precisely defined and are always the same. This burning technique reduces the amount of sparks by 99%. The intelligent airflow lets the floor of the heater remain cool while heating only the sides of the heater.

The burn chamber can be filled with up to 3.5kg of wood pellets – resulting in a total heating time of up to six hours (approximately three hours of visible flame phase with another three hours of glowing phase).
